ORANGE WHITE CHOCOLATE BARK WITH CRANBERRIES & APRICOTS RECIPE - (4.2/5)



Orange White Chocolate Bark with Cranberries & Apricots Recipe - (4.2/5) image

Provided by raklisa2020

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 (12-ounce) package white chocolate chips
1/4 teaspoon McCormick® Pure Orange Extract
1/4 cup almonds, sliced
1/4 cup dried apricots, chopped
1/4 cup dried cranberries

Steps:

  • Microwave chocolate chips in large microwavable bowl on HIGH for 1 1/2 to 2 minutes or until almost melted, stirring after 1 minute. Stir until chocolate is completely melted and mixture is smooth. Stir in orange extract. Spread on large foil-lined baking sheet to 1/4 inch thickness. Sprinkle with almonds, apricots and cranberries, pressing lightly into chocolate with spatula. Refrigerate about 10 minutes or until firm. Break into irregular pieces to serve. Store in tightly covered container at cool room temperature or in refrigerator up to 5 days.

WHITE CHOCOLATE BARK



White Chocolate Bark image

Ina Garten loves to make chocolate bark for the holidays as a quick and colorful candy. Temper the chocolate in a microwave as a foolproof and easy solution.

Provided by Ina Garten

Categories     dessert

Time 2h25m

Yield 16 pieces

Number Of Ingredients 4

1/2 cup whole shelled salted pistachios
16 ounces good white chocolate, finely chopped
1/4 cup dried cranberries
1/4 cup medium-diced dried apricots

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Using a pencil, draw an 8-by-10-inch rectangle on a piece of parchment paper. Turn the parchment paper over so the pencil mark doesn't get onto the chocolate and place it on a sheet pan.
  • Place the pistachios in one layer on another sheet pan and bake for 8 minutes. Set aside to cool.
  • Place three quarters of the white chocolate in a heat-proof glass bowl and put it in the microwave on high for 30 seconds. (Time it with your watch for accuracy.) Stir the chocolate with a rubber spatula, return it to the microwave for another 30 seconds, then stir again. Continue to heat and stir in 30-second intervals until the chocolate is just melted. Immediately stir in the remaining chocolate and allow it to sit at room temperature, stirring often, until it's completely smooth. (If you need to heat it a little more, place it in the microwave for another 15 seconds.)
  • Pour the melted chocolate onto the parchment paper and spread it lightly to fill the drawn rectangle. Sprinkle the top evenly with the cooled pistachios, the cranberries, and apricots. Press the nuts and fruit lightly so they will set in the chocolate. Set aside for at least 2 hours until firm or refrigerate for 20 minutes. Cut or break the bark in 16 pieces and serve at room temperature.

CRUNCHY WHITE CHOCOLATE-ORANGE BARK



Crunchy White Chocolate-Orange Bark image

Provided by Claire Robinson

Categories     dessert

Time 1h25m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 pound good quality white chocolate, chopped (recommended: Callebaut)
1 teaspoon pure orange extract
Orange paste food coloring
1 cup crisped rice cereal
1/2 cup golden raisins

Steps:

  •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or silicone baking mat.
  • Create a double boiler by putting a glass bowl over a saucepan of barely simmering water, making sure the bowl doesn't touch the water. Add the chocolate and orange extract and stir until melted and smooth. Do not overheat white chocolate or it will seize.
  • Remove the bowl from the pan and wipe the condensation from the bottom. Put about 2 tablespoons of the chocolate in a small bowl and tint it with the food coloring.
  • Add the puffed rice and raisins to the large bowl of chocolate and stir until well combined. Pour the mixture onto the baking sheet and with an offset spatula, spread it to an even thickness, about 1/4-inch. Tap the pan firmly several times on the counter to settle the chocolate. With a small spoon or fork, drizzle stripes of orange tinted chocolate over the surface of the bark.
  • Refrigerate the chocolate for 1 hour to completely set before breaking it into large pieces. Serve immediately or wrap in cellophane bags tied with festive ribbon and keep on hand as a quick hostess gift!

WHITE CHOCOLATE CRANBERRY-ORANGE BARS



White Chocolate Cranberry-Orange Bars image

This is my take on my mother's recipe for chocolate chunk bars, which she made every Christmas Eve. Our family is scattered across the country now; making these reminds me of home. If you don't have a pastry cutter, you can use two sharp knifes or a potato masher. My mom makes this with semisweet chocolate chunks. -Erin Powell, Amarillo, Texas

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 40m

Yield 2 dozen.

Number Of Ingredients 10

1-1/2 cups all-purpose flour
1/2 cup packed brown sugar
1/2 cup cold butter, cubed
FILLING:
1 large egg
1 can (14 ounces) sweetened condensed milk
1 teaspoon grated orange zest
1 teaspoon orange extract
1-1/2 cups white baking chips
1 cup dried cranberries

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°. Line a 13x9-in. pan with foil, letting ends extend up sides; grease foil. In a bowl, mix flour and brown sugar; cut in butter until crumbly. Press onto bottom of prepared pan. Bake until light golden brown, 10-12 minutes. Cool on a wire rack., For filling, whisk together egg, milk, orange zest and extract until blended; stir in baking chips and cranberries. Spread evenly over crust. Bake until top is golden brown, 20-25 minutes longer. Cool 15 minutes in pan on a wire rack. Lifting with foil, remove bars from pan. Cut into bars. Refrigerate leftovers. Freeze option: Freeze cooled bars in freezer containers, separating layers with waxed paper. To use, thaw before ser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 214 calories, Fat 9g fat (5g saturated fat), Cholesterol 26mg cholesterol, Sodium 66mg sodium, Carbohydrate 31g carbohydrate (25g sugars, Fiber 1g fiber), Protein 3g protein.
